Output 59bd9beea1709a2bb424925fdc089f031d27596f81ab7f4f6f6e23a558e5aa5c:146

value
1229566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8887fa64a1febda04fda6febe86802ead319935 OP_EQUAL
address
3NtYD93mH1dG36i2UR6CsTES5KC6F9pTeF
transaction
59bd9beea1709a2bb424925fdc089f031d27596f81ab7f4f6f6e23a558e5aa5c
spent
true